Basic research, also called fundamental or pure research, is essentially a search for something new without assuming directly at the outset that there's practical applicability. It usually arises from pure or inquisitive 'why?' and has the capability to be directed toward an understanding of underlying principles or theories. Of course, it lays the foundation for other applied research and technological innovations in the future.
Applied research is done to solve the actual problems facing humankind or to answer applied research questions based on the information gathered through fundamental research. It searches for solutions that can be directly applied to fields like health, engineering, or education. In this way, it acts as a bridge between theory and practical life.
Descriptive research meaning can be understood as it observes, records, and analyzes the characteristics of a phenomenon without changing the variables involved. It aims to give an overall view of a situation, an event, or a group of people. It may be conducted through surveys, case studies, or other observing techniques. There is no such conclusion related to cause and effect but gives rich meanings to the "what" of a subject.
Exploratory research looks into researching a problem or subject that has not been adequately explored. Moreover, it could discover new ideas, make hypotheses, or present research questions for use in later, more detailed investigations. Explanatory research is often used at the initiation of an investigation to obtain initial information.
Explanatory or causal research tries to establish cause-and-effect relations between the variables. Researchers manipulate one or more independent variables to observe their effects on the dependent variable to establish causal links. This kind of research is common in experiments to affirm or negate theories.
Correlational research is the examination between two or more variables in terms of discovering the relations without a manipulation by the experimenter. In a manner of speaking, the intention may also involve establishing some patterns and connection, though this does not occur to create causation. The strength and directionality of relationships are measured using statistical tools such as correlation coefficients.
Qualitative research delves into the rich field of depth understanding of experiences, perceptions, and social phenomena through non-numerical data. Information is gained through interviews, focus groups, and ethnography-rich detailed content. The idea is to explore meanings and context, but it will not produce generalized quantifiable results.
Quantitative research relies on numerical data and statistical procedure to quantify variables and to seek patterns or relationships. Data are commonly collected through surveys, experiments, and, at times, observational studies. It highlights measurable elements and aims for generalization through statistical analysis.
Action research is essentially an iterative process carried out in a mode of problem-solving attitude; often, it is on education or social work. Action research meaning can be understood as it engages participants in collaboration for topics, solutions, and measuring outcomes. It aims at producing actionable results that support improvement of best practices or conditions over time.
Longitudinal research studies the same subjects over a prolonged period, noting trends and development through time. It works well to monitor changes of trend, behavior, or health status across time. It can establish causality and study the long-term impact of interventions.
Cross-sectional research entails data collection from a population or sample at one point in time. It is applied in the analysis of the prevalence of variables or behaviors within a stipulated group. While it may predict associations, it will not elicit cause-and-effect relationships or change in time.
It focuses on understanding the subjective lived experience of people pertaining to a particular phenomenon. The research aims at describing the essence of those experiences by collecting minute, detailed personal accounts through interviews or observations. The research seeks to uncover the common meanings of this experience and the subjective nature of experience.
Case studies would involve an in-depth study of a single case or small number of cases in a real-world setting. Case studies generally allow an in-depth understanding of complex phenomena, such as company, individual, or community. Cases are often analyzed from a variety of data sources and prove to be very useful in providing insights into unique or rare situations.
Historical research refers to the study of past events, documents, or trends aimed at understanding the degree to which they have created the present. The reconstruction and interpretation of past events are based on primary and secondary sources, including archives, records, interviews, with the aim of giving a detailed and honest account of history.
Mixed-method research, therefore, combines both qualitative and quantitative approaches in a single study. This approach seeks to bring out the best from both kinds of approaches to give a fuller and holistic understanding of a research problem. In that sense, it is possible to offer the most robust conclusions when combining numerical data with insightful and deep understanding.
Research refers to the scientific method of investigation that aims at achieving the discovery of new information, verification of existing knowledge, or solution to specific problems. The characteristics describe the validity and integrity of the process and ensure that findings are valid and applicable.
The characteristic of research is its systematic nature. In this regard, a structured methodology is followed in research-from posing the question through to gathering and analysing data. A systematic methodology ensures that the process of research is not haphazard but rather systematized and replicable, meaning others can then test and, if necessary, validate the findings.
It is pegged on empirical evidence, which a researcher derives through the observation, testing, or gathering of data. This basis on observable and measurable data sets research apart from mere speculations since its conclusions are made of facts, not opinions.
The other important aspect of research is objectivity, which stresses the point that any research study should be as neutral and unbiased as possible. Bias in the design of a study, in data gathering, and in an analysis is thoroughly minimized so that the conclusions drawn out of a study are valid and trustworthy anywhere.
The possibility to allow other researchers to reproduce the study with similar results is replicability. This characteristic is important for determining whether research-based knowledge has been grounded, and it supports the argument that knowledge developed through research is verifiable by third parties.
Research inherently adds value to the knowledge pool in a given field. Whether it confirms prevailing theories, challenges established thought or promotes the introduction of new concepts, research stimulates investigation and enhancement in countless fields.
The objectives of research form the guiding framework that identifies the purpose and goals of the study. Clearly defined objectives not only guide the research process but also aid in judging its significance or impact.
Defining the research problem is, therefore, one of the major purposes of research. In this process, the main issues or questions that the study will answer are determined, hence laying a foundation for a clear and relevant study.
Research contributes to the corpus of knowledge in a given field. It can validate previous results or take up a new idea to better understand a given aspect for better decisions in future study or practice.
The use of information gathered in research empowers choice based upon evidence. From policy formulations, business strategy options to educational practices, results of research tell stakeholders informed choices embedded on data.
Another purpose of research is to evaluate the outcomes of certain interventions or practices. Through comparing the effectiveness and impacts of various approaches, researchers can differentiate the best practices from those that require improvement leading to an improved effectiveness in practical applications.
Lastly, research objectives may always include innovation, or otherwise the investigation of new technologies, methods, or solutions to existing problems which can lead to breakthroughs or innovations in various fields.

Asking individuals questions to find out what they think or do is known as survey research. A student might, for instance, create a survey to find out what their classmates prefer about school lunches. The student can determine which meal is the most popular by tallying the responses. We can better comprehend people's choices and perspectives thanks to this type of research.
Conducting an experiment or test to observe the results is known as experimental research. To determine which flower grows better, a student might, for instance, plant two flowers, give one sunlight, and leave the other in the dark. This type of study aids in our understanding of cause and effect. In science, it is frequently utilized.
The study of historical events is the focus of historical research. Students can learn about ancient Egyptian culture by watching movies or reading texts. They could learn about life in those days by looking at old photographs, maps, or writings. We can learn about history and how the world has changed thanks to this kind of inquiry.
Descriptive research is done to describe what something is like right now. For instance, a student might compose a report on the appearance, diet, and behavior of the animals in a nearby zoo. Without attempting to alter anything, this type of research provides comprehensive data about a subject.
This type of research involves observing, listening, or posing open-ended questions. For instance, to find out how classmates feel about homework, a student may conduct interviews with them. The student listens to their stories and writes about what they said rather than tallying the responses. This study contributes to our understanding of emotions and experiences.
Quantitative research involves learning about a subject by using measurements and data. A student might, for instance, tally the number of kids who take the bus, walk, or ride bikes to school. They may then create a graph to display the outcomes. This kind of research uses mathematics to demonstrate patterns.
